📜  Lodash _.size() 方法(1)

📅  最后修改于: 2023-12-03 15:02:47.099000             🧑  作者: Mango

Lodash _.size() 方法

简介

Lodash是一个开源的JavaScript工具库,提供了许多实用的方法来加强JavaScript的功能。其中,_.size()方法用于获取对象或数组的长度。

语法和参数
_.size(collection)
  • collection (Array|Object): 要计算大小的集合。
返回值

(number): 返回集合的长度。

示例
计算数组长度
const arr = [1, 2, 3, 4, 5];
const size = _.size(arr);
console.log(size); // 5
计算对象长度
const obj = {name: 'Alice', age: 20, hobby: ['reading', 'music']};
const size = _.size(obj);
console.log(size); // 3
注意事项
  • _.size()方法可以计算普通的JavaScript对象、数组以及类数组对象的长度。
  • 计算对象的长度时,只会计算对象自身的属性,不包括继承的属性和原型链上的属性。
  • 如果传入的是一个非对象或数组的值,则返回0。
参考文献